Two 1914-1920s photo albums/scrap books belonging to Cecily Gaisford St Lawrence of Howth Castle in Ireland. The albums contain photos, newspaper cuttings, signatures, holidays, family etc, and the bulk of the collection covers horses, racing, social events, Highland Games, visits to other stately homes, invitations etc, there is an important military content. Cecily had 3 brothers serve in WW1, her eldest brother Thomas Julian Edward was a Captain in the Seaforth Highlanders and was awarded the MC & 2 bars and was wounded 3 times, her middle brother Lawrence served in the Royal Navy and was granted rank of Cmdr in recognition of his war service and her youngest brother Cyril Hugh served in the Scots Greys and was dangerously wounded in the First Battle of Ypres and awarded the an MC in 1918. There are various photos of the 3 brothers in uniform and also a range of photos of the Scots Greys on active service, RN warships etc. An interesting lot to a well-connected family.
